    Fixing a faulty Cylinder

    composite door frame repair doors are strong and are a great investment for any home, but they're not impervious to abrasions or damage. They can sometimes get warped or swell in the frame, and they can be difficult to close and lock. There is a simple solution that will save you money and time.

    The most common problem is the locking mechanism becoming sticky. The cause of sticky locks is when dirt, dust and debris build up in the internal mechanisms of the door cylinder. This can cause the lock become more difficult to insert or turn and can even result in a broken key. Fortunately this issue is simple to solve by using an lubricant made of silicone.

    Begin by loosening the screws that are holding the strike plate. Then you can move it either vertically or horizontally to align it with the latch. Once you have done this you can tighten the screws. This will ensure your piston is properly seated, and will stop the door from bending or sagging later on.

    If you're still having issues, it might be worth consulting an expert. A uPVC expert can help diagnose the issue and suggest an answer. If the problem is the multipoint locking mechanism, you might require a replacement of the entire mechanism. In this situation it is recommended to hire an expert locksmith who is familiar with these mechanisms and composite doors. They can help you to determine the issue and fix it as quickly as possible. They can also give you guidance on the best security fittings for your door. It's important that you choose high-security locks that are Kite Marked and certified to BS3621. They are more resistant to forced entry attempts and are covered under your insurance policy. This makes them a great choice for your new composite doors. It is highly recommended that you have an Yale alarm installed to your home to give you peace of mind. This is a further security feature that a lot of insurance companies require as a prerequisite to be covered.

    Repairing a damaged door hinge

    A damaged hinge can cause a huge issue and could compromise the security of your home. It is usually not a difficult problem to fix. Make sure you use the correct tools and be cautious when doing the repair. It is recommended to contact a professional locksmith if you aren't sure what to do. This will help you avoid infringing your insurance policy on your home and making the problem worse.

    One of the most common problems with composite doors is that they are sticky. This is typically caused by debris or dust build-up within the lock's internal mechanism. This can be corrected using a lubricant spray. Always select a lubricant that is designed specifically for door locks and locks. Other options, such as WD-40, may damage your lock.

    Another issue that can arise with composite doors is warping. Extreme weather conditions can lead to warping of both the door and frame. This can result in gaps around the edges of the door, which allow drafts and rainwater into your home. This can also affect locking mechanisms and make it difficult for you to shut the door.

    The best way to prevent this is to keep the door shut as much as is possible and then lift the handle when closing it. This will help relieve pressure on the middle lock and stop warping.

    Lastly, it is important to ensure that the hinges are in good condition. If you notice that the screws are loose and you want to tighten them, you can tighten the screws by removing the hinges and screwing them back in. You may want to replace the screws with longer ones. This will save your time and money as well as will ensure that the hinges are secure.

    These simple steps can fix a faulty hinge quickly and quickly. It is also a good idea keep your hinges lubricated regularly to avoid any problems. This is particularly important when you use your door frequently.

    Composite doors can warp, swell or bow. This is caused by changes in temperature and humidity. The good thing is that this issue can be fixed with just a few steps. You should first get into the habit of throwing the handle every time you close your composite door (also called throwing the lock). This will ensure that all locking points are engaged, and will prevent any future swells, bowing, or warping.

    Composite doors can also be difficult to lock and close. This can be due to a variety of reasons, including inadequate quality and an absence of maintenance. If your door made of composite has not been properly lubricated it may get stuck or latch improperly. This can affect the security of your home as well as its energy efficiency.

    If you notice that your composite door is sticking to the wall, it's a good idea to apply silicone lubricant to the inside of the lock. This will smooth out the mechanisms, and prevent any issues that might occur with your lock's hinges, cylinders, or keys. This must be done at a minimum every month to ensure your composite door hinge replacement door remains in good working order.

    If you're having trouble turning the key in your composite door, it's most likely that you've got a defective euro cylinder or mechanism. A locksmith can fix this issue and also provide you with new keys. In extreme cases an entire replacement of the mechanism could be required.

    A malfunctioning locking mechanism could be one of the most irritating and frustrating issues with a composite door. It can be difficult to open and lock your door. This can pose danger to you and your family. The good thing is that you can fix most of these issues fairly easily. If the issue is with the cylinder or the internal locking mechanism These simple steps will assist you in getting your door working in a matter of minutes.

    A issue with the door lock is typically caused by the internal mechanism getting stuck. This can be caused by dirt, dust or debris accumulating in the locking cylinders or hinges. Using a silicone- or graphite-based lubricant can assist in removing this issue and bring back the functionality of your composite door. This should be done every six months to avoid future problems.

    Another common problem is when the locking mechanism becomes damaged. The multipoint locking system operates the various locking points of your composite door, therefore if one of these components is damaged, it could be difficult to unlock or shut the door. A professional locksmith can resolve this problem by replacing the faulty component and providing you with new keys.

    If your composite door is bent or the hinges are rusting, it can be difficult to open and shut the door. This could result in an increase in safety and increase the chance of water leaks. The simplest solution to this issue is to simply change the hinges, which can be done quickly and easily using a couple of tools.
